Choosing the Right Facility

Selecting the right dog daycare facility can significantly impact your pet’s happiness and well-being. Start by researching local options, checking online reviews, and asking fellow pet owners for recommendations.

Visit potential facilities to observe their environment. Look for cleanliness, ample space for play, and secure fencing. Make sure staff members are friendly and knowledgeable about canine behavior. This will ensure that your furry friend enjoys a positive experience while in their care.

Understanding Your Dog’s Needs

Every dog is unique, with its own personality and preferences. Understanding these traits is essential when considering dog daycare. Observe how your dog interacts with other dogs and people. This insight will guide you in selecting the right environment.

Consider their energy levels too. Some breeds thrive in active playgroups, while others may prefer a quieter setting. Knowing what makes your furry friend comfortable ensures they enjoy their time away from home and get the most out of their daycare experience.

Evaluating Daycare Programs

When evaluating daycare programs, pay attention to the facility’s cleanliness and safety measures. A well-maintained environment is essential for your dog’s health and happiness. Look for secure play areas, proper fencing, and adequate ventilation.

Next, consider the staff-to-dog ratio. Smaller groups often mean more personalized attention. Observe how caregivers interact with the dogs; their enthusiasm can indicate a positive atmosphere. Don’t hesitate to ask questions about daily routines and activities to ensure they align with your dog’s needs and personality.

Transitioning Your Dog into Daycare

Transitioning your dog into daycare can be a smooth process with the right approach. Start by introducing them gradually, allowing for short visits at first. Observe their behavior and comfort level during these initial outings.

It’s important to communicate with the staff about any specific needs or concerns you have regarding your dog’s temperament and habits. This ensures they receive appropriate attention and care.

Patience is key as some dogs may take longer to adjust than others. With consistent exposure, encouragement, and positive reinforcement, most dogs thrive in a daycare environment, enjoying socialization and play while you’re away.
